Bottom fishing in the stock market refers to the strategy of buying stocks that have fallen sharply in price, under the belief that they are undervalued and will eventually rebound.

BSE INDEX

Bottom fishing is not about guessing the lowest price, but about identifying strong companies temporarily beaten down. Done carefully, it can be a smart value strategy; done recklessly, it risks “catching a falling knife.”
